M-F 7AM-3PM POSITION SUMMARY
This position is responsible for safely operating the extrusion press in order to produce aluminum extruded shapes that meet customer specifications, and for participating in 5S initiatives in the extrusion press area.
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
The following description of work to be performed by this individual is not intended to be all-inclusive. Rather, it focuses on the major tasks that must be accomplished. Ensure that safety is always the number one priority at Alexandria Industries; promote and support a safe work environment and safety oriented culture by following all safety programs and guidelines Set up and run equipment safely and efficiently in order to maximize output while meeting customer quality requirements Support the company's key corporate values, objectives and strategies Cross-train in as many functions in the department as possible Understand and verify manufacturing orders in order to identify internal and customer specifications Conduct all processes and procedures in accordance with department key measures Ensure all quality practices are being followed accurately and efficiently Keep work area clean and orderly using 5S system (standardize, sustain, sort, set in order and shine) Meet delivery schedules to ensure customer service and satisfaction Efficiently operate the extrusion press in order to maximize processes and operations Analyze and monitor extrusion process data per process control plan and extrusion process sheets Use log calculation to make billet adjustments Set up and modify extrusion process sheets Properly take and inspect samples at all operations of press cell according to customer required surface finish and tolerances Make changes to the press schedule as necessary Meet delivery schedules to ensure customer service and satisfaction Perform general machine maintenance as necessary to keep equipment in a well maintained condition

M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S
Education:
High school diploma or equivalent degree
Experience:
3+ years of manufacturing experience required Other required
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ities:
Basic computer skills (Outlook, Excel, Word, PowerPoint, and production/inventory systems) Ability to recognize safety concerns Ability to utilize the proper inspection equipment such as calipers, micrometers, and other measurement tools Basic math skills Ability to read die drawings and inspect parts and surface finish according to customer specifications Ability to effectively work in a team environment Ability to perform and assist with preventive maintenance Ability to properly identify materials Strong written and verbal communication skills Effective problem solving skills Ability to multi-task Complete understanding of the age cycle and the effect it has on the material Ability to use the overhead cranes and lift trucks Understand all processes occurring before and after extrusion Understand dedicated customer expectations in regards to on-time delivery and quality
